The Nuts and Bolts: Core Components
1. Battery Chemistry Choices
Your storage backbone comes down to three main options:
- Lithium-ion (LiFePO4) – 90% of new installations
- Lead-acid – Budget option at 40% lower cost
- Solid-state – Emerging tech with 2x energy density
Wait, no – let's clarify. While solid-state batteries are making headlines, most homeowners should still consider lithium-iron-phosphate (LFP) batteries. They've got 6,000+ cycle lifetimes compared to lead-acid's 1,200 cycles[3].

Hidden Essentials Most DIYers Miss
Our team recently audited 20 failed installations. The common missing pieces?
- Arc fault detectors (AFCI)
- Thermal runaway containment
- Battery management system (BMS)
A BMS isn't just "nice to have" – it's your insurance policy against catastrophic failure. Quality systems monitor individual cell voltages within 0.01V accuracy[5].
